General description
trans-4-Methoxy-3-buten-2-one acts as substrate and undergoes zinc triflate-catalyzed Mukaiyama-Michael reaction with 3-TBSO-substituted vinyldiazoacetate to yield functionalized 3-keto-2-diazoalkanoates[1].
Application
trans-4-Methoxy-3-buten-2-one was used as starting reagent for enantioselective total synthesis of (-)-epibatidine.
